SFIFSH305
Locate fishing grounds and stocks of fish
Assessment tool
Version 1.0
Issue Date: May 2024
This unit of competency describes the skills and knowledge required to position the fishing operation to locate concentrations of fish and fishing environments. It includes the ability to use electronic aids and sources of information to position the vessel and locate fishing grounds.
The unit applies to individuals who have responsibilities for locating suitable environments for fishing operations.
All work must be carried out to comply with workplace procedures, according to state/territory health and safety, biosecurity and environmental regulations, legislation and standards that apply to the workplace.
Licencing and regulatory requirements apply to this unit. Users are required to check with the relevant maritime authority for requirements.
